| Northeastern men's rowing accepting walk-on candidates
Previous competitive athletic experience is necessary. Those that have competed successfully in high school sports tend to adapt well to the systematic training and teamwork necessary in the sport of rowing.
Practice typically runs from 5-7:30 p.m. Classes should be scheduled to conclude by 4:30 p.m. during the Fall semester.
Invited walk-ons can expect to compete in several races this fall, a chance to be invited to the winter training trip in Cocoa Beach, Fla., Dec. 30-Jan. 7, and compete in the spring intercollegiate racing season leading towards the Eastern Sprints and National Championship in May.
The goal of the Northeastern men’s rowing team is to win the Eastern Sprints and national championship. It is not a participatory process, but rather a process that rewards unyielding focus on excellence, acts of courage and shared sacrifice.
